Overview
BS EN ISO 6142-1:2015 outlines the gravimetric method for the preparation of calibration gas mixtures, specifically focusing on Class I mixtures. This standard is essential for laboratories and industries that require precise gas analysis and calibration. The gravimetric method ensures accuracy and reliability in the preparation of gas mixtures, which is crucial for compliance with various regulatory requirements.
Key Requirements
- Preparation Method: The standard specifies the gravimetric method for preparing calibration gas mixtures, ensuring that the mixtures are accurate and traceable.
- Class I Mixtures: Focuses on Class I mixtures, which are defined by specific concentration ranges and purity levels.
- Equipment Specifications: Details the necessary equipment and conditions for the preparation process, including balances, gas cylinders, and environmental controls.
- Quality Control: Emphasizes the importance of quality control measures throughout the preparation process to maintain the integrity of the gas mixtures.
